What Does It Mean When Your Dog Licks Its Paws A Lot. Read on to learn more. Dogs lick their paws for many reasons. Skin irritation and dry dog paws often result from environmental allergies. If your dog is licking or chewing his paws a lot, this could indicate a health or behavioral problem. Dry or itchy skin is one of the most prevalent reasons why your pup may be licking their paws excessively. Some dogs lick their paws on a daily basis to keep them clean, but if your dog is licking their paws constantly or aggressively, it may be a sign of a problem, such as an injury or infection. If you see your dog frequently licking their paws, it's time to take some action. When licking becomes excessive, however, it is usually a sign that something is wrong, as it can indicate anxiety, stress, boredom, pain, or an underlying health condition.
